# TensorFlow 2.0 Object Detection API

1. 모델 파일을 자동으로 다운로드합니다.
2. OpenCV를 활용하여 이미지를 입력받습니다.
3. 검출된 `classes`, `scores`, `boxes`를 반환합니다.
4. 간단한 시각화를 지원합니다.

## Using
```python3
# Using GPU computing
import tensorflow as tf
physical_device = tf.config.list_physical_devices('GPU')
tf.config.experimental.set_memory_growth(physical_device[0], enable=True)
# Model Prediction
from core.detection import ModelZoo
model = ModelZoo(ModelZoo.SSD_MobileNet_v2_320x320)
img, input_tensor = model.load_image('images/dog.jpg')
classes, scores, boxes = model.predict(input_tensor)
visual = model.visualization(img, classes, scores, boxes, 0.7)
# OpenCV Visualization
import cv2
cv2.imshow("visual", visual)
cv2.waitKey()
```
